Witryna14 cze 2024 · Cervical spondylosis is a general term for age-related wear and tear affecting the spinal disks in your neck. As the disks dehydrate and shrink, signs of osteoarthritis develop, including bony projections along the edges of bones (bone spurs). Cervical spondylosis is very common and worsens with age. WitrynaRadiculopathy describes a range of symptoms produced by the pinching of a nerve root in the spinal column. The pinched nerve can occur at different areas along the spine (cervical, thoracic or lumbar). Symptoms of radiculopathy vary by location but frequently include pain, weakness, numbness and tingling. If the MRI and clinical findings correlate and result in a diagnosis of cervical myelopathy, surgery is typically recommended. WitrynaA spinal cord injury damages the spinal cord itself or nearby tissues and bones. Depending on the severity of the injury, you may lose function or mobility in different parts of your body. You’ll be diagnosed with cauda equina syndrome if you have two sets of symptoms: Bowel, bladder and/or sexual problems. Paresthesia of the backs of your legs, butt, hip and inner thighs. WitrynaLumbar decompression surgery is a type of surgery used to treat compressed nerves in the lower (lumbar) spine. It's only recommended when non-surgical treatments haven't helped.
